I also hated the Protein shakes post-op. Then I tried Muscle Milk Lite - they're not a milk product and they don't taste like Protein. They come in either little plastic bottles or cartons, they have somewhere between 120 and 200 calories depending on the size and most have upwards of 20 grams of protein. Please do yourself a favor and try one. The vanilla Cream is really really sweet but the chocolate is very good.

I bought the book too! I have tried several of the options. The foundation of milk (I use skim) a scoop of Protein powder and flavorings (frozen fruit, fruit, ice cubes, flavored sugar free syrups) still have that Protein smell. I did find that orange juice helps cut the smell. I can get a chocolate Boost down every day. I put it in the freezer at work and get it out before it freezes, drink some and put it in the fridge and continue the cycle. I can now get the 8oz container down by noon each day. I have tried several powders and haven't found a favorite yet. Good luck with your recipes!
